I actually did this exact same thing and I think I did the XP-7 taper because of weight. I will measure mine later to verify that. Lilja short chambered for me so i was able to hand turn the final chamber.
I dont know how it will work in taco. I have a tall Ken Light Hi Rise and a rear grip and recoil is no problem of course. I do not have a muzzle break on mine and it is in 300 whisper. I bought the action from Brownells and it was advertised as an over run blem. Remington supposedly made them for the US military and theactions are marked 300 ACC. I have never seen a caliber marked on an action before.
I have a solid follower block glued in so it is a single shot.
I received mine and did not designate on the 4473 what type of firearm it was to become and i have kept the original box.

Sorry to take so long to verify.
And dont ever trust my memory. It was a terrible thing to waste.
My barrel from Lilja was an XP-11 which is their closest to a Remington taper.
